Use the verbs “gustar,” “tener,” “ser,” and “estar” to give the following information about yourself and your friend: name, age,
LenKa [72]
Name: Soy (your name). [I am ____]

Age: Tengo (age in numbers in Spanish) años. [I have ___ years. -a bit odd, but that's how it's said.]

Description 1: Soy (you could ethnicity, or a personality description/physical description?). {americano (American), comico (funny), alto/a (tall), bajo/a (short)} (I am _____)

Description 2: Estoy (you could use a physical condition). {enfermo/a (sick), cansado/a (tired)} (I am ___)

Feelings: Estoy (emotion). {bien, triste, mal, más-o-menos, etc.} [I am_____]

Something you like: Me gusta (something- a sport maybe, or an infinitive (to run, to sing)). {béisbol, baloncesto, correr, cantar} (I like __)
